Embodiment 1
[0021] Example 1. Such as figure 1 As shown, it includes a fuselage 2 that is vertically passed by the rotating shaft 1 from the side. The two ends of the rotating shaft 1 are symmetrically distributed with respect to the fuselage 2. A power mechanism 3 that drives the rotating shaft 1 to rotate is provided in the fuselage 2. The power mechanism 3 is a motor. , the two ends of the motor shaft of the motor are extended, the motor shaft of the motor is the shaft 1; both ends of the shaft 1 are provided with an adapter 4, the adapter 4 is connected to the propeller 5, and the adapter 4 is hinged with a width direction The wing 6 perpendicular to the plane of rotation of the propeller 5; the wing 6 is provided with a turning mechanism that makes the wing 6 rotate around the adapter seat 4, and the plane of rotation of the wing 6 is parallel to the plane of rotation of the propeller 6; when the UAV is in the In the state of high-speed level flight, the wing 6 rotates to the direct...
